I have finally set up my craft studio in our new house. I am totally spoilt as I have the entire bonus room over our two car garage. The cabinets down the sides of the room are mirror images-half is for stamping-the other half is for sewing. The island is on wheels and I am able to seat 8 stamping buddies around it when we get together to stamp. One end of the room (not shown) has a wall to wall U shaped counter for sewing in front of a nice big window which makes the room really bright. The other end is set up with furniture and accessories from Ikea containing most of my stamping supplies. My stamp sets are stored in the drawers of the cabinets along with other extra supplies.
